Rayma
Rayma blew out a breath as she sat on the bench in the corner of the room and put on her shoes. She had to get out of the gym. Her relaxation technique was no longer working since Camden stormed through the door looking hot, dirty, and grumpy.
And God, that body. Why did he have to have such an intriguing body? Even with the mud and gunk all over him, and the frown that defined the hard but oh-so-beautiful features of his face. No man should look that good. He’d be a lot easier to ignore, a lot easier to handle, if he wasn’t so freaking hot.
She yanked on her shoes, tied them, then stood. Camden hadn’t moved, only continued to frown at her as he held the tall can of beer at his side.
“Well, I’ll leave you to your shower,” she said as she stomped to the door.
He vaulted toward her and gripped her arm.
“Ow.” She tried to shake him off, but he only softened his hold. No matter how lax, his hands were like an iron grip. Not effeminate like Mike’s or even Keegan’s.
“You can’t be writing articles on things you know nothing about.” His hard-edged voice sent tremors to her stomach.
“Well, I won’t be anymore, thanks to your group.”
“Why didn’t you give that tip to the police and let them handle it?”
“I tried at first. Nobody did anything about it, and everybody said I was crazy. Then I figured most of the cops were involved.” She blinked at him, aware he wanted to know why she decided to pursue the information on her own. She regretted that decision now. If she hadn’t decided to probe, she’d still have her job at News 12, still be safe in her own apartment and not thinking about falling into bed with Camden Alexander.
And she’d still be bored out of her mind.
“Look, you’re not going to understand why I do what I do, and I won’t understand why you do what you do. So let’s leave it at that.”
“So you sought out his CPA?”
“It wasn’t that difficult.” Actually, it’d been a lot easier than Rayma had imagined. She’d gone to an art gallery during a fundraiser, and Mike had immediately been smitten. She only played hard to get for a couple days so as not to lose her chance to nab his interest.
Camden dropped his hold and backed away. Flecks of sand lined the sheen of his muscles like golden dimples on his skin. A slurry of dirt and God knew what should have made him repulsive, but it didn’t.
I guess I like my men dirty. God, she was an idiot. A complete and total idiot.
She pivoted toward the door and made her exit before she did anything stupid. Like kiss him, or join him in that shower. She was done with making reckless decisions, and dreaming of Camden and the way his body felt next to hers was definitely reckless.
